2026 Hotel Bedding Trends: Crafting Ultimate Guest Sleep Experience

Time : 2026-07-01

In the highly competitive modern hospitality landscape, user review patterns show a profound shift toward wellness, sensory luxury, and hyper-personalized comfort. Selecting the right commercial bedding is now a critical strategy to boost online ratings, drive direct bookings, and maximize customer lifetime value. Drawing from deep industry insights and evolving guest data, this report outlines the foundational hotel bedding trends shaping 2026.

1. Immersive Sensory Experiences

Modern travelers actively seek immersive sensory experiences, and their first interaction with a hotel bed is visual and tactile. In 2026, guest reviews frequently highlight the texture, weight, and feel of linens. A bed must look flawless on camera to satisfy the demand for social-media-ready content, but it must perform even better when the guest slides between the sheets.

To capture this trend, properties are moving toward high thread count commercial sheets engineered with weaving techniques. Rather than focusing solely on thread count numbers, 2026 is the year of the weave structure:

1) Sateen Weaves: Offer a lustrous, silky sheen and a draping quality that looks luxurious in promotional photography and guest Instagram posts, evoking an immediate sense of high-end opulence.

2) Crisp Percale Weaves: Favored by boutique and luxury resort properties for their matte finish, cool hand-feel, and that coveted five-star hotel crispness that communicates pristine cleanliness.

2. Textile Innovation & Performance

The intersection of sleep science and textile technology has reached maturity in 2026. Guests expect their sleep environment to actively regulate their physiology to ensure deep, uninterrupted rest. Savvy hotel owners are prioritizing performance fabrics that solve common sleep disruptors while optimizing housekeeping workflows.

1) Thermoregulation & Enhanced Sleep Quality: Advanced fibers pull excess heat away from the body during initial sleep phases and release it later, preventing nighttime micro-awakenings and improving guest satisfaction scores.

2) Antimicrobial & Hypoallergenic Properties: Post-pandemic health consciousness remains a primary driver. Incorporating antimicrobial hotel mattress protectors and treated fills creates a barrier against dust mites, allergens, and bacteria, allowing hoteliers to confidently market allergen-free premium rooms.

3) Anti-Static & Wrinkle-Resistant Finishes: From an operational standpoint, textiles engineered to resist static build-up and minimize wrinkling reduce pressing times in industrial ironers, lowering labor and utility expenditures.

3. The Customizable Sleep Menu

In 2026, leading properties empower guests to curate their own sleep configurations. Providing custom choices directly influences positive TripAdvisor and Google reviews, positioning your brand as a customer-centric leader.

Implementing customizable hotel pillow menu options is the highest-ROI method to achieve this. Guests can select their preferred loft (height) and firmness level—ranging from plush down options for side sleepers to firm memory-foam alternatives for back sleepers. Furthermore, properties are integrating interchangeable layers, such as lightweight waffle-weave blankets, down-alternative duvets, and adjustable plush mattress toppers, allowing guests to fine-tune their sleep surface to their exact physical needs.

4. Color Psychology & Aesthetic Accents

While classic, sterile all-white bedding remains the baseline for hygiene verification, 2026 hospitality design embraces color psychology to establish emotional connections. Instead of replacing full linen sets, hotels use accent pieces to add warmth, depth, and local character.

By strategically integrating decorative pillows and texture-rich bed runners, designers can evoke specific psychological states. Muted terracottas, sage greens, and deep ocean blues are utilized to lower heart rates and induce tranquility. These accents break visual monotony, mask minor operational wear, and give the bed a structural, layered look that commands room rates.

5. Green Sustainability

Eco-responsibility is now a strict procurement mandate under modern corporate ESG frameworks. B2B buyers require verifiable transparency. Achieving prominence in sustainable hospitality textile trends means sourcing linens that carry recognized organic or eco-certifications.

Hotels are shifting toward organic cotton, bamboo-derived Tencel, and high-durability recycled poly-blends. Crucially, true sustainability in 2026 translates to structural durability. A linen that can withstand 150+ industrial washes without losing its structural integrity or graying prevents premature replacement cycles, reducing water, chemical, and landfill waste.

6. Smart Bedding Integration

As smart hospitality ecosystems expand, bedding is evolving to interact with in-room ambient controls. 2026 introduces linens designed to complement smart hospitality tech. These include fabrics engineered to work optimally with smart mattresses that adjust firmness based on real-time biometric tracking, as well as weaves that do not interfere with under-mattress sleep monitoring sensors, providing a bridge between physical comfort and digital wellness insights.
